Anna is making 11 necklaces using 35 beads for each. How many beads (B) are needed to make all of the necklaces?

Well 11 necklaces using 35 beads. Its technically 35 beads per necklace. so multiply 35 and 11.  So 35*11=385. So you need 385 beads in all.
